8-16 It's a half kill pot with the "kill pot" being on the button.

Early position player calls and I have KdTs two off.

1) No particular reads on players so should I fold, call or raise?

I call with cutoff calling and button "kill pot" raising. BB, early, myself and cutoff call five ways two bets.

Flop comes AdJh4d and everyone checks.

2) Turn comes Ac and it's checked to me. Is it worth a bet?

I bet and button calls all others fold.

3) If I don't hit Q on river for my straight, should I bet river? What rivers do I check and which ones do I bet?

4) Is check call a viable choice?

I don't like limping in and playing multiway with KTo when I have 100% chance of being out of position against the kill poster. I don't think it's terrible but I'm hard pressed to find what to like about it.

Typically the kill poster will defend widely so when raising you don't steal the post often, so essentially I'd play really tight in front of the kill poster.

I don't stab at this pot on the turn, I take it down about never unless it's a super weak tight table and my image is super nitty (happens, but rarely). Anyone with a Q or pocket pair knows you're just stabbing at it most of the time.

I fold this pre

I don't hate the turn bet but I would need a read that the checkers are truly weak. You have a bunch of outs against a small to mid pocket pair when behind. Your probably better off checking and hoping for the free card.

As played, just check/fold. The button probably has a mid to decent pocket pair and could make a good thin v bet.
